August 31, 2012 - Following a summer of cancellations, Van Halen has closed the curtain on its 2012 world tour by canceling the final two Japanese shows originally slated for November due to health issues with Eddie Van Halen.
March 8, 2007 - Legendary guitarist Eddie Van Halen, whose band recently postponed a planned summer tour with original frontman David Lee Roth, has checked himself into a rehab facility.
January 22, 2007 - Eddie Van Halen made a Friday (1/19) appearance at the annual NAMM convention in Anaheim, CA, during which he and Fender Guitar unveiled a limited-edition replica of the guitarist’s famous red-black-and-white striped guitar.

April 27, 2001 - Edward Van Halen issued a statement on Thursday night (4/26) confirming that he has cancer. The news comes 11 months after the legendary guitarist first said that he was participating in a clinical trial to prevent cancer at a renowned cancer hospital in Houston; hospital spokespeople said at that time that Van Halen did not have the disease.
May 30, 2000 - update: The M.D. Anderson Cancer Center in Houston said on Tuesday (5/30) that, contrary to widespread rumors, guitarist Eddie Van Halen does not have cancer.
